Day 1: Moshi to Southern Serengeti National Park (Ndutu Area)
Moshi to Southern Serengeti National Park (Ndutu Area)

Moshi to Southern Serengeti National Park (Ndutu Area)

Your migration safari begins early as you depart from your hotel in Moshi, heading to the Ndutu region on a 5.5-hour drive covering 260 km. Along the way, you’ll enter the Ngorongoro Conservation Area, where the scenery shifts from hilly forests to lush grasslands. Upon arrival in Ndutu, embark on a half-day game drive, pausing for a picnic lunch. The sweeping grasslands merge into the Serengeti, forming part of the migration route for over 2 million wildebeests and countless zebras, antelopes, and gazelles. During the prime season (December, January, February to March), witness the plains transform into calving grounds, attracting predators seeking vulnerable young wildebeests. Ndutu Lake and Lake Masek also draw wildlife during the dry season. Your action-filled game drive concludes around 5 PM, followed by dinner and a well-deserved rest at your chosen accommodation.

Day 3: Serengeti National Park (Ndutu to Serengeti to Central Serengeti National Park)
+
Serengeti National Park (Ndutu to Serengeti to Central Serengeti National Park)

Serengeti National Park (Ndutu to Serengeti to Central Serengeti National Park)

After breakfast, head to the iconic Serengeti National Park, renowned as the world’s most celebrated wildlife destination. As you journey through the vast, endless plains, the breathtaking view of grasslands stretching to the horizon will leave you in awe. Covering 14,763 sq km, the Serengeti is home to the famous “Big 5” (elephant, rhino, buffalo, lion, leopard) and the elegant Impala. The park supports the largest concentration of plains game in Africa. Discover the unique Serengeti “Kopjes” – towering granite boulders that provide shelter to diverse flora and fauna. Enjoy a picnic lunch amid the stunning landscape during your day-long game drive. As the day winds down, savor a hearty dinner and a restful night at your accommodation.

Day 5: Ngorongoro Crater to Arusha
+
Ngorongoro Crater to Arusha

Ngorongoro Crater to Arusha

On the last day of your safari, you will have an early start. Finishing up with a quick breakfast you will make an early descend into the crater floor. The Ngorongoro crater is the world’s largest inactive, intact and unfilled volcanic caldera. It has a massive floor of about 260 sq kms with a depth of over 2000 feet. The 5-hour game drive in the crater floor, will show you a lot of animal action. Keeping the camera ready is definitely recommended. The African elephant, buffalo, Black rhino, Hippos, Hyenas, Cheetahs and Lions are found in plenty. Post the picnic lunch at the beautiful Hippo pool, you will begin a steep ascend to the top exit of the crater. This is the last leg of your safari, with a 4hr drive left to Arusha. You will be dropped off to your preferred location in Arusha by 6PM in the evening. With an incredible experience and loads of memories to cherish, this is the time you bid goodbye to your team.
